YH51 YBR is a 2001 Ford Escort in White with a 1,753cc diesel engine. This vehicle has been through 18 MOT tests with a personal pass rate of 72.2%.
Across all 2001 Ford Escort models, the average MOT pass rate is 66.4% with a typical mileage of 87,573 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Ford Escort fails its MOT is suspension component mounting prescribed area is excessively corroded, accounting for 465,333 recorded failures. If you're considering buying YH51 YBR, it's worth having these areas checked by a mechanic before committing.
The Ford Escort typically stays on UK roads for around 38 years. At 25 years old, this Ford Escort is well into its expected lifespan but still has years ahead.
